Sure sports are great, and I did a lot of them; track, cross country, basketball, and volleyball. However, I was never really close with any of my teammates nor was I that good at any of them. I wasn't the worst but I wasn't the best either. To be really appreciated in sports it almost feels like you have to be the best.
In eighth grade I had the opportunity to join the high school marching band, and my grandmother kind of forced me to do it. At first I was not too thrilled about it, and with all the time it took I had to drop out of the sports I was in, but honestly it was the best thing I ever did. To be a good band member, not only do you have to be good at your instrument, but you must be close with your teammates as well. One wrong move and the whole show is ruined.
Band is family, not matter what anyone says. I have never met a group of people that has cared more than my band family, and I would not trade them for the world. Chances are, if you join the band you will be with the same group of people anywhere from 3-5 years which in itself is impressive. How many sports do that?
In band we helped and depended on each other, not just with the music and marching, but other stuff as well. I knew I could always count on one of the kids in my section to help with homework, music, or personal stuff. Each section had its own "mother" and "father", then there was the collective band "mother" and "father", we really were close. Even the parents that would help out were referred to as "Momma *insert first or last name here*" or "Papa *insert first or last name here*". We took care of each other in band.
In sports I was athletic and healthy, but in band I was even more so. Playing and marching requires a lot of muscle work and burns a lot of calories, not to mention running before and after practice. In band I took better care of myself than I ever had. I made sure to eat right, get plenty of water and sleep.
